WF-O1331 Technical Specifications
| Parameter | AndroidSBC WF-O1331 (O2O digital signage display terminal) | Industry Average |
|---|---|---|
| Processor | Allwinner A133 quad-core ARM Cortex-A53 1.6GHz 64-bit SoC | Older 28nm or 40nm quad-core SoC |
| Process node | 22nm low-power | Older 28nm or 40nm process |
| GPU | PowerVR GE8300 | Older Mali-450 or basic GPU |
| NPU / AI | Basic vision engine | No NPU on competing entry boards |
| Memory | 2GB LPDDR4 | DDR3 1GB / 2GB on competing boards |
| Storage | 8GB eMMC | eMMC 5.0 8GB / 16GB on competing boards |
| Display output | single HDMI 4K 60fps | Single HDMI 1080p only on competing boards |
| Touch support | Optional capacitive touch overlay | Resistive single-touch on competing boards |
| Operating system | Android 10 | Android 8 or Android 9 on competing boards |
| Connectivity | WiFi 5 plus Bluetooth 5.0 plus Gigabit Ethernet | WiFi 4 plus 10/100M Ethernet on competing boards |
| Payment peripherals | QR code scanner, NFC, barcode scanner, thermal printer, cash drawer | No bundled payment-peripheral driver SDK on competing boards |
| Operating temperature | 0C to 50C | 0C to 40C on competing boards |
All parameters in the table above are measured at 25C ambient.
